McLAUGHLIN v. BENDERSKY

No. 87 C 7446.

705 F.Supp. 417 (1989)

Ann McLAUGHLIN, Secretary of the United States Department of Labor, Petitioner, v. Alex BENDERSKY, D.D.S., and Bendersky Professional Corporation, Respondents.

United States District Court, N.D. Illinois, E.D.

January 26, 1989.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Peter B. Dolan, U.S. Dept. of Labor, Office of the Sol., Sp. Litigation Div., Washington, D.C., for petitioner.

Sheldon Chertow, Marvin A. Miller, Chicago, Ill., for respondents.


MEMORANDUM OPINION

BRIAN BARNETT DUFF, District Judge.
